Xebia

Senior Java Developer

Xebia

full-time

Posted on:

Location Type: Remote

Location: Poland

Visit company website

Explore more

AI Apply
Apply

Salary

💰 PLN 18,000 - PLN 28,000 per month

Job Level

About the role

  • building and maintaining production-grade backend software with a strong focus on quality, reliability, and maintainability
  • developing backend features and services using Java and Spring Boot
  • collaborating closely with other engineers through code reviews, design discussions, and shared ownership
  • contributing to software design using established engineering principles and component-based architecture
  • working in an agile environment and actively participating in team ceremonies
  • supporting continuous improvement of backend development practices, tooling, and automation

Requirements

  • strong experience in backend development using Java (7+) and Spring Boot
  • experience building and maintaining REST API and working with WebSockets
  • understanding of software design principles and backend architectural patterns
  • experience with unit and integration testing, including BDD or TDD practices
  • familiarity with CI/CD pipelines and version control systems such as Git
  • exposure to cloud platforms (AWS or similar environments)
  • awareness of DevOps principles and automation practices
  • strong communication and collaboration skills
  • growth mindset and willingness to continuously improve backend expertise
  • very good English (B2+)
Benefits
  • Professional development budgets
  • Guilds and Labs for growth
  • Community support and meetups

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ard skills
JavaSpring Bootbackend developmentREST APIWebSocketsunit testingintegration testingBDDTDDbackend architectural patterns
Soft skills
communicationcollaborationgrowth mindsetcontinuous improvement